Improving the resilience, accessibility and quality of health and long-term care, including measures to advance their digitalisation; increasing the effectiveness of public administration systems. Improving social and territorial infrastructure and services, including social protection and welfare systems, the inclusion of disadvantaged groups; supporting employment and skills development; creating high-quality, stable jobs. Promoting the roll-out of very high-capacity networks, the digitalisation of public services, government processes, and businesses, in particular SMEs; developing basic and advanced digital skills; supporting digital-related R&D and the deployment of advanced technologies.

Having considered that severe COVID-19 is largely related to a cytokine storm,cytokine profiles of COVID patients were assessed during a recovery.
The number of lymphocytes in peripheral blood of COVID-19 patients in the earlyand late stages of recovery and healthy subjects were assessed by an automatedcell counter system UF-100® (Sysmex, Kobe, Japan) within 3 h aftercollecting blood samples. The results of this study provide evidence to show that COVID-19 patients, who needto hospitalization, had some changes in the immune system during the diseaserecovery to improve and regulate immune responses. Thesefindings were consistent with other reports indicating the number of CD8+ T cellswas markedly decreased and its function was exhausted in COVID-19 patients.29 In contrast with the percentage of activated CD4+ T cell which was increasedin the early stage of recovery, the activated CD8+ T cell had the reduced frequency;however its number was significantly increased in the late stage of recovery, unlikeactivated CD4+ T cell number. The results indicated thatpatients had the reduced number of lymphocyte in comparison with healthy subjects.In line with this finding, Qin et al. declared that patients with COVID-19 had areduction in T cell number accompanied by the severity of the disease.
